Ashlee Simpson to Divorce Pete Wentz

Cites the ever-popular 'irreconcilable differences'

By Kate Seamons,  Newser Staff

Posted Feb 9, 2011 11:44 AM CST

(Newser) – The Simpson sisters are 0 for 2 when it comes to marriage: Ashlee Simpson today filed for divorce from rocker hubby Pete Wentz, who she married in May 2008. Sources tell TMZ there is (shocker!) no prenup. On Simpson's wishlist: joint legal custody of 2-year-old Bronx Mowgli, primary physical custody, and spousal and child support.
